Find the mean, median, and mode of the data. 67, 59, 34, 71, 59

Answer:

mean 58

median 59

mode 59

Step-by-step explanation:

67, 59, 34, 71, 59

The mean is the sum divided by the number of numbers

(67+ 59+ 34+ 71+ 59)/ 5 = 290/5 = 58

The median is the middle number  when the numbers are written from smallest to largest

34,   59, 59, 64, 71

The middle number is 59

The median is 59

The mode is the number that appears most often

The number 59 appears twice

59 is the mode

Question 12 (1 point) Given P(A) 0.34, P(A and B) 0.27, P(A or B) 0.44, what is P(B)? Answer in decimal form. Round to 2 decimal
Tema [17]

Answer:  The required probability of event B is P(B) = 0.37.

Step-by-step explanation:  For two events A and B, we are given the following probabilities :

P(A) = 0.34,    P(A ∩ B) = 0.27   and   P(A ∪ B) = 0.44.

We are to find the probability of event B, P(B) = ?

From the laws of probability, we have

P(A\cup B)=P(A)+P(B)-P(A\cap B)\\\\\Rightarrow 0.44=0.34+P(B)-0.27\\\\\Rightarrow 0.44=0.07+P(B)\\\\\Rightarrow P(B)=0.44-0.07\\\\\Rightarrow P(B)=0.37.

Thus, the required probability of event B is P(B) = 0.37.
